Software Development Engineer

1 week ago


Surabaya, Indonesia THE SOFTWARE PRACTICE PTE. LTD. Full time

The Software Practice

We started our firm working with entrepreneurs who brought expertise in specific industry verticals but required a technical team that could help them realise their product ideas. We partnered with them as their product teams helping them build their MVP, talk to customers and refine the product, raise money, and even hire their in-house tech teams while remaining as consultants.

Now, our work spans across both public and private sectors where we've done several CTO-for-hire and product-team-for-hire gigs for entrepreneurs and enterprises looking to move fast. Our clients range from small start-ups looking to build and launch their product from scratch, to large enterprises (e.g. Government Agencies in Singapore such as DSTA, NEA, A*STAR and PUB) requiring innovative solutions in critical business workflows. Our enterprise clientele includes some of the largest SE Asian banks, Fortune 500 IT firms and one of Asia’s largest airports.

Openings
- Front-end (Javascript) developers
- Web developers
- Mobile developers (Kotlin and Swift)

**Requirements**:

- Solid programming ability in at least one language
- Clear and precise written communication. A large part of our team works remotely and it's vital that you are able to document ideas, progress and problems with clarity so everyone can work asynchronously.
- You must be happy to work independently (remote welcome) and be able to structure timelines, take ownership and responsibility and communicate clearly.
- We're looking for people with under 6 years’ experience - fresh graduates welcome too.
- Proficiency in written and spoken English is a must.

Any experience in the one or more of the following is a definite plus:

- Built large projects in VueJS/ReactJS/Svelte/Angular
- Web design experience - HTML/CSS
- Experience with AWS, Azure, Heroku or any other cloud platforms
- **Development in C# or Python and.NET**

If you've built something in the past, do let us know. Github and/or StackOverflow profiles are welcome.

**Salary**: From Rp8,000,000 per month

**Education**:

- S1 (preferred)

**Experience**:

- Software Development Engineer: 2 years (required)

**Language**:

- English (required)



  • Surabaya ꦱꦸꦫꦧꦪ, Indonesia Geniebook Full time

    Job OverviewWe are seeking an experienced Engineering Director - Software Development to join our team. In this role, you will be responsible for leading and mentoring software engineers, ensuring high-quality development, scalability, and security of our software products.You will oversee sprint planning, task allocation, and project timelines to align with...


  • Surabaya ꦱꦸꦫꦧꦪ, Indonesia camLine Full time

    About camLineEstablished in 1989, camLine has been delivering innovative IT solutions for production automation and logistics. With years of experience in this sector, we possess a unique understanding of the competitive market.At camLine, our focus is on reliability – both of people and software. We develop software that seamlessly integrates business...

  • Software Engineer

    7 days ago


    Surabaya, Indonesia SEVIMA Full time

    **As Senior Software Engineer, you will be expected to**: Develop frontend and backend systems of a product (creating, adding feature, improving etc.) Lead approximately 7 - 8 people in engineering team Maintain and develop team's performance by sharing knowldge and one-on-one session regularly Collaborate with Product team to identify and improve core...

  • Software Developer

    4 days ago


    Surabaya, Indonesia PT Global industri teknologi solusi Full time

    Persyaratan SOFTWARE DEVELOPER / PROGRAMMER QUALIFICATIONS D3/S1 on Informatics Engineering and its kind GPA Minimum is 2,75 Minimum 1-3 years experience as Technical consultant with ERP solution (more preferred Microsoft BC) **Having experience on Microsoft Programming such as**:.net, vb, c# or web programming Having programming skill Business Central...


  • Surabaya ꦱꦸꦫꦧꦪ, Indonesia Geniebook Full time

    Job DescriptionWe are seeking an experienced Senior Software Engineering Manager to lead and mentor our software engineering team. As a key member of our engineering leadership team, you will be responsible for ensuring high-quality development, scalability, and security of our software products.You will oversee sprint planning, task allocation, and project...


  • Surabaya ꦱꦸꦫꦧꦪ, Indonesia Geniebook Pte. Ltd. Full time

    Role OverviewWe are seeking a highly skilled Senior Software Engineering Manager to join our team. The ideal candidate will have a strong background in software engineering, leadership, and project management.Key ResponsibilitiesLead and Mentor: Lead and mentor software engineers to ensure high-quality development, scalability, and security.Sprint Planning...


  • Surabaya ꦱꦸꦫꦧꦪ, Indonesia Geniebook Pte. Ltd. Full time

    Job OverviewWe are seeking a seasoned Senior Software Engineering Manager to lead our software engineering team. As a key member of our leadership team, you will be responsible for overseeing the development and implementation of cutting-edge technology solutions.Key ResponsibilitiesTeam Leadership: Provide guidance, mentorship, and coaching to software...


  • Surabaya ꦱꦸꦫꦧꦪ, Indonesia Teknik – Perangkat Lunak (Teknologi Informasi & Komunikasi) Full time

    ResponsibilitiesLead and mentor software engineers, ensuring high-quality development, scalability, and security.Oversee sprint planning, task allocation, and project timelines to align with business goals.Drive technical innovation and oversee R&D for new features.Implement and enforce engineering best practices, including DevOps, system architecture, and...


  • Surabaya ꦱꦸꦫꦧꦪ, Indonesia Geniebook Full time

    Lead and mentor software engineers, ensuring high-quality development, scalability, and security.Oversee sprint planning, task allocation, and project timelines to align with business goals.Drive technical innovation and oversee R&D for new features.Implement and enforce engineering best practices, including DevOps, system architecture, and performance...

  • Software Engineer

    7 minutes ago


    Surabaya, Indonesia GrowthFn sdn bhd Full time

    Yellow Messenger is looking for Software Engineers in the Customer Engineering team to own the channel development of conversational channels for the Enterprises. The channels will be built using node js. **Responsibilities**: - Build the next generation of AI-based conversational channels such as bots etc. - Work with Customer, Engineering Manager &...


  • Surabaya, Indonesia PT B2BE Solutions Indonesia Full time

    A. PURPOSE OF ROLE:The Software Development Team Lead role will be tasked to lead and manage a software engineering team in an agile development environment and share our passion and great pride in leading a team that strongly believes in design and build high-quality next generation enterprise software.The roles of Software Development Team Lead will...


  • Surabaya, Indonesia Prahu-Hub Full time

    Title: Software Product Development - Pria/Wanita, maksimal 25 Tahun - Pendidikan mínimal S1 Informatika / Sistem Informasi - Mengerti arsitektur software dan spesifikasi sistem - Memiliki pengetahuan bahasa pemrograman web dan android (serta memahami konsep API) - Memahami Software Development Life Cycle (SDLC) - Mengerti tentang desain UI UX dan tools...


  • Surabaya, Indonesia Prahu-Hub Full time

    Title: Software Product Development - Pria/Wanita, maksimal 25 Tahun - Pendidikan mínimal S1 Informatika / Sistem Informasi - Mengerti arsitektur software dan spesifikasi sistem - Memiliki pengetahuan bahasa pemrograman web dan android (serta memahami konsep API) - Memahami Software Development Life Cycle (SDLC) - Mengerti tentang desain UI UX dan tools...


  • Surabaya, Indonesia camLine GmbH Full time

    Founded in 1989, camLine has been actively providing IT solutions for production automation and logistics. Our decades of experience in this sector gives us a head start in this competitive market. At camLine, our clear focus is on one thing: the reliability of people and software. We develop software that reliably connects business processes with...

  • Software Testing

    15 minutes ago


    Surabaya, Indonesia Gaia Dental Full time

    Gaia Dental - a dental and healthcare company based in Australia and Indonesia - is hiring for a position! **SOFTWARE TESTING** Are you passionate about ensuring software quality and delivering flawless user experiences? Join our dynamic team as a Software Testing Engineer and play a crucial role in shaping the reliability of our cutting-edge software...


  • Surabaya, Indonesia PERSOLKELLY Indonesia Full time

    **Location**: - Surabaya- Surabaya**Work Type**: - Full TimeRequirement: - Education Minimum D3/S1 preferably from informatics engineering/ information system - Experience minimum 2 years in IT/ related field - Willing to be placed in Surabaya (WFO) - Understand the basics of making ERD (Entity Relationship Diagram) and UML - Able to understand the...


  • Surabaya, Indonesia PERSOLKELLY Indonesia Full time

    **Location**: - Surabaya- Surabaya**Work Type**: - Full Time**Salary**: - 7,000,000 to 12,000,000Requirement: - Education Minimum D3/S1 preferably from informatics engineering/ information system - Experience minimum 5 years in IT/ related field - Willing to be placed in Surabaya (WFO) - Understand the basics of making ERD (Entity Relationship Diagram)...


  • Surabaya, Indonesia PT. Anugerah Wijaya Raga Full time

    Lead the engineering team to set the tone, culture, vision, strategy, and quality bar of the engineering function Oversee performance, promotions, escalations, learning and development, and more as the "manager of last resort" for your teams Manage a group of primarily Engineering Managers, with Individual Contributor Engineers and other adjacent roles as...


  • Surabaya, Indonesia PT Otto Menara Globalindo Full time

    Company Description **_ **Qualifications**: **Requirements **To be considered for the position, you must satisfy the following: - A minimum of 5 years experience as a Software/ Backend Developer - Strong knowledge in PHP and Python (if you are mastering the other programming language, you are also welcome to apply) - Strong knowledge of SQL (familiarity...


  • Surabaya, Indonesia PT.Sarana Maju Lestari Full time

    **Requirements**: - Pendidikan mínimal S1 IT/Management/Marketing/Lainnya - Minimal 2 Tahun pengalaman sebagai Tech Sales/Business Development pada perusahaan IT Software Solution - Memiliki relasi yang kuat pada sektor B2B dab B2G - Memiliki kemampuan komunikasi, presentasi, serta negosiasi yang baik - Memiliki kemampuan analisa data, riset, dan...